        <description>Created in 1961 by the Highway Safety Foundation and Safety Enterprises, Inc., "Mechanized Death" is a legendary driver's education scare film that underscores the dangers of speeding and reckless driving. Made in an era when automobiles lacked the kind of modern safety features and crash-resistant designs that we take for granted today, and featuring bloody accident footage supplied by the Ohio Highway Patrol, "Mechanized Death" reveals the highways and byways as nightmarish avenues of carnage and destruction. The film remains absolutely relevant today, with its cautionary tales about risk taking, speeding, and -- death. This film from the Ohio State Highway Patrol delivers a powerful message about the devastating consequences of careless driving. Through a series of real-life crash reconstructions, it highlights the deadly impact of speeding, overconfidence, fatigue, mechanical neglect, and driving under the influence. Innocent lives are lost due to preventable choices—rushed decisions, ignored safety measures, and impaired judgment. The recurring plea is clear: take time to think. Whether it's resting during long trips, using seatbelts, or refusing to drive under the influence, drivers hold the responsibility for their own safety and the safety of others.
